▼Points of attention when syncing with Microsoft Teams
- Installations of third-party apps need to be permitted.
(Org-wide app settings on Teams > Turn on "Allow third-party apps") - Unipos can be linked to multiple teams.
If multiple teams are linked to Unipos, posts are displayed on only one channel under the linked teams. - You can't specify users to link Unipos to.
- The registered email address on Microsoft Teams and Unipos must match.
- Only the Unipos admins can link Unipos and Microsoft Teams.
▼How to sync/unsync with Microsoft Teams
1. Click "Teams" > "・・・" > "Manage team".
2. Click "Apps" > "More apps".
3. Find "Unipos App" on MSTeams App page.
4. Click "Add to a team".
※Note: Be sure to select "Add to a Team" from the toggle button on the right, not "Open".
5. Type the team name you want to sync with, then click "Set up a bot".
6. If you succeed to sync with "Unipos App", the below welcome message shows up on the General channel.
7. If you wish to change the channel type @unipos and choose "Channel integration settings".
8. A modal window will pop up for you to change the linked channel. After you make a choice, click "Update". (The example shows the channel "notice".)
※Private channels will not be included in the choice.
9. Once the linked channel is update, the following message will be displayed.
You will receive Unipos notifications in the channel which you have just selected.

▼How do I unlink Microsoft Teams?
Please follow the procedures below.
1. Open the Admin Center and click "Apps".
2. From the list of apps, click the bin icon next to Unipos.
3. Click "Uninstall".
Unipos will be removed from the list of apps on Teams.
Team admin screen on Unipos will also show "Not linked".
